When Google looks at a website to determine where to place it in its search results it considers two main things. One of the considerations is On Page SEO; the other is Off Page SEO. S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ization and is often the term used to shorten the phrase and make it more human and machine friendly.

Off Page SEO is generally speaking other websites that link to yours. Off Page SEO is one determining factor that Google looks for when ranking a site in their search engine. This is broken up into many different criteria. One of those is the quality a site that links to yours, if the website that links to yours is high in status, like a major successful website for example, this will have an impact on how Google looks at your website and where they rank you. Obviously many of these links will improve your websites positioning further.

Google also uses something that is more controllable for you as a webmaster, something that every webmaster should polish with every website they own. Some simple techniques can often get you ranking higher in the search engines almost instantly. I am talking about the other determining factor On Page SEO.

On Page SEO is basically optimizing your website for the search engines. To do this you need to operate by programming language rules like HTML for example and the search engine guidelines. Search engines in total use over 200 SEO factors. Obviously it would be impossible to optimize a website to follow them all. Some come naturally and you will find you website abides by many of these factors already but others need to be polished.

Now some On Page SEO ranking factors will always remain evasive and it is more or less impossible to abide by them all. Sometimes you will find polishing one factor means you are scoring lower in another factor, it can be very frustrating. The key is to abide by as many as possible. Most webmasters who optimize their websites do so by a series of educated guesses a long with what we know already. One recent On Page SEO factor is the websites loading speed. Google have said this will not hold a lot of weight in ranking but it is something they now consider when positioning a website. To overcome slow loading pages you can do simple things to cut down the size of your website, like smaller lower resolution images, hosting videos on third party sites and embedding them into yours rather than uploading and even keeping brief summaries of your content on your home page with click in options for more information.

Optimizing your website can take hours upon hours and most people skip On Page SEO in favour of Off Page SEO. This is a mistake people make far too often but always wonder why their website is not ranking well in Google. To have a website that is placed in the top 10 search results, On Page SEO needs to be looked into as well as Off Page. If not you could be sitting outside the top 10 until it is.

Is your website geared towards Google Caffeine?

Bing has pushed Google hard, and challenges in search are always welcome because they bring out the best in the industry. And with the intention of Google to come up with a new version of ranking criteria and name the new algorithm as Google Caffeine, there is an expectation of how well it can change the way we use ‘Search’ everyday. There is something in it for everyone.

What is your comfort level with Google Caffeine? Is your website ready to make the most of it? Or are you planning to wait … watch?

Why did Google decide on launching a new algorithm? Well, FTC is coming hard on all those viagra, acai berry affiliates who have abused search in more ways than one. Probably, Google foresaw this trend and wanted to clean its own search. And this could have been one of the most important factors for Google to work on algo changes and improve the overall experience. And this is the precise reason why Google is concentrating more on the on-page factors more than it has done in the past.

The intent of Google Caffeine is to make the search cleaner, more relevant, faster and more friendly to the users. And in doing so, it will set to rest the spammers’ sites promoting products in not the 100% ethical means.

There is not much knowabout Caffeine to make any statement at this point. However, it is expected that the search criteria will focus on the content part of the website along with the off-page factors like backlinks. At present, there are more than 200 rank criteria in Google algorithm. A tweaking of these will probably be geared towards making the algo more in line with what Bing uses today.
